05 Powder Mage (Mcclellan, Brian) Like numerous books on this record, The Powder Mage Cycle doesn’t contain just one magic process. even so, the a single synonymous with its identify stands out probably the most, and it’s straightforward to see why. Powder Mages get their magical means from snorting gunpowder, allowing for them to heighten their senses, mature much better, develop into faster, and manipulate explosions. These consumers are excellent marksmen, capable of propel bullets more quickly and with much more accuracy. working with powder a lot of can cause blindness, but mages are frequently pushed to these kinds of extremes when battling conventional magic users known as ‘The Privileged’.
